What is Healthcare Software?
Healthcare software development refers to digital applications designed to improve medical care, hospital administration, and patient engagement. These tools help doctors, hospitals, and clinics manage health records, provide remote care, analyze patient data, and deliver better treatments.
It can be as simple as a mobile app to schedule appointments or as complex as a hospital management system that handles billing, patient records, pharmacy, and diagnostics—all in one platform.

Types of Healthcare Software
Healthcare software is not limited to one solution. There are many types, each serving a unique purpose. Let’s look at some of the most widely used ones:
1. Electronic Medical Records (EMR)
EMR systems are digital versions of paper records used in clinics. They store patient history, prescriptions, lab results, and treatment details.
2. Electronic Health Records (EHR)
EHRs are broader than EMRs. They allow multiple doctors and hospitals to access a patient’s complete history. For example, a cardiologist in one city can view past treatment given by another doctor in a different city.
3. Telemedicine Software
Telemedicine apps allow patients to consult doctors online. This has become a game-changer, especially after the COVID-19 pandemic. Patients can receive care without traveling, saving time and cost.
4. Remote Patient Monitoring (RPM) Software
Remote Patient Monitoring solutions use connected devices like blood pressure monitors or glucose meters to track patient health in real-time. Data is shared with doctors, helping them adjust treatments quickly and improve outcomes.
5. Hospital Management Software (HMS)
Hospital management systems are complete platforms for hospitals. They manage patient admissions, staff schedules, billing, pharmacy, inventory, and even insurance claims.
6. Medical Imaging Software
This software is used to process and store X-rays, MRIs, CT scans, and other medical images. It helps radiologists analyze results more effectively.
7. e-Prescription Software
Doctors can send prescriptions digitally to pharmacies. This reduces errors, saves time, and ensures medicines are delivered correctly.
8. Healthcare Mobile Apps
These include apps for fitness, diet tracking, mental health, and chronic disease management. Patients are now more engaged in their health than ever before.
9. Billing and Insurance Software
Hospitals use billing systems to handle patient invoices and insurance claims. Automation here reduces financial errors.
10. AI and Data Analytics Tools
Artificial Intelligence is helping predict diseases, personalize treatment, and improve decision-making in healthcare. Data-driven insights are transforming preventive care.

Challenges in Adopting Healthcare Software
While healthcare software development has many advantages, hospitals also face challenges in implementing it:
- High Initial Cost – Developing and integrating advanced systems requires investment.
 - Data Security Concerns – Patient data is sensitive and must be protected from cyber threats.
 - Training Needs – Doctors and staff need proper training to use new technologies.
 - System Integration – Combining different software into one smooth system can be complex.
 - Resistance to Change – Some healthcare providers are hesitant to shift from traditional methods.
 
Future of Healthcare Software
The future of healthcare is moving rapidly toward a fully digital ecosystem where technology plays a central role in improving care. One of the biggest trends is Artificial Intelligence (AI), which is already helping in the early detection of diseases and supporting robotic surgeries with higher precision and efficiency. AI-driven insights will also assist doctors in making faster and more accurate decisions.
Another breakthrough is Blockchain Technology, which ensures the safe and transparent exchange of sensitive patient data across different hospitals and healthcare providers. This reduces the risk of data breaches while improving trust and security.
Wearable devices such as smartwatches, glucose monitors, and heart rate sensors are also gaining popularity. These tools continuously track patient vitals and send real-time updates directly to doctors, allowing early interventions and better management of chronic conditions.
Virtual Reality (VR) is being used for both medical training and patient rehabilitation. Doctors can practice complex surgeries in a simulated environment, while patients can benefit from VR therapies for physical and mental health recovery.
Finally, cloud-based healthcare systems will allow hospitals to store, access, and share data seamlessly. Together, these innovations will make healthcare software more personalized, predictive, and preventive, ensuring better outcomes for patients worldwide.
